Points to note

Layouts are successful when the format works in harmony with the image

A good layout is not the same as a pretty layout. It must show the reader what to choose, where to look and what to do next. That is why the format is just as important as the image itself.

Format

A single work may have several images

If the format changes, so does the layout. An invitation, menu, label or advert cannot simply be the same design scaled to a different size.

Print

A small mock-up highlights the errors

Minor errors in print become very noticeable: text that is too small, poor contrast or uneven edges. The image on screen may differ from the printed result. 

Movement

An advert needs one strong idea

A short advert needs a single hook. When there are too many ideas in a single shot, people don’t have time to grasp any of them.
